1.

FLASHCARD QUESTION

Front

What is the net force?

Back

The net force is the overall force acting on an object when all the individual forces are combined. It determines the object's motion.

2.

FLASHCARD QUESTION

Front

What does Newton's 3rd Law of Motion state?

Back

Newton's 3rd Law states that for every action, there is an equal and opposite reaction.

3.

FLASHCARD QUESTION

Front

What causes a change in motion?

Back

A change in motion is caused by unbalanced forces.

4.

FLASHCARD QUESTION

Front

If two forces of 10 N to the right and 20 N to the left are acting on an object, what is the net force?

Back

The net force is 10 N to the left.

5.

FLASHCARD QUESTION

Front

What is an example of balanced forces?

Back

An example of balanced forces is when two people push a car with equal force in opposite directions, and the car does not move.

6.

FLASHCARD QUESTION

Front

What happens when the net force on an object is zero?

Back

When the net force is zero, the object remains at rest or continues to move at a constant velocity.

7.

FLASHCARD QUESTION

Front

If a 5 N force pulls to the right and a 3 N force pulls to the left, what is the net force?

Back

The net force is 2 N to the right.
